Position Overview

This position works cooperatively with leadership of the congregation that owns the school (if any), LUMIN’s Board of Directors, school staff, parents and students to help the school accomplish its mission of nurturing and equipping all children in a strong Christian and academic environment to become life-long learners, growing in faith, capable of making responsible decisions, and serving God and the community. The Teacher will conduct student instruction, classroom monitoring, behavior modification, and nurturing of students.

Key responsibilities may include, but are not limited to, the following:

  • Follow Christian-based philosophy and principles, plan, prepare and teach the prescribed curriculum for the grade and/or subject areas(s) he or she is teaching.
  • Implement, execute, and measure academic success at the classroom level. Assist with the ongoing review and improvement of processes and procedures related to the school. Follow established teaching protocols and programs to ensure consistency among all schools.
  • Work cooperatively and interact positively with students, parents, staff and community. Oversee classroom discipline and escalate issues to appropriate personnel, as applicable.
  • Work cooperatively and interact positively with students, parents, staff and community.
  • High presence and availability to all students, faculty and parents.
  • Monitor students during break, lunch and recess.
  • Supervise co-curricular activities, as needed.
  • Support rotational duties with other teachers such as, but not limited to, before-school supervision, after-school supervision, leading faculty devotions and detention room monitor. Administrative
  • Participate and attend school functions and faculty meetings.
  • Provide leadership in ensuring a positive and co-operative culture and climate exists within the school.
  • Provide structure, directions, and evaluation of Teacher’s Aid (when applicable).
  • Prepare for and attend teacher conferences as scheduled, and as needed for individual students.
  • Participate in faculty devotions.
